Evaluating Concept Design Model of Fishing Vessels
A concept design model of the Mediterranean fishing vessels is developed jointly by the University of Trieste and University of Zagreb [1]. It was presented in various stages of development since 1987. A wide database of fishing vessels makes it possible to improve the reliability of parameter relations in the design model. The model is included in the multi-attribute design procedure, which explores design space and produces Pareto-optimal (non-dominated) designs in multi-attribute environment. Within these non-dominated designs final design is selected by searching for minimal distance to the ideal design using fuzzy concept to describe aspiration level, subjective decision making and Chebyshev metric in the decision space. In order to make the model practical, it must be tested, evaluated and compared to existing vessels. It is the only way of establishing the level of confidence. Of all the attributes evaluated by the model the seakeeping related ones were founded on the relatively slim basis. Data obtained by the systematic calculation of seakeeping merit of the data base vessels made a suitable basis for prediction of seakeeping quality. In order to obtain better insight in the seakeeping-related attributes prediction by the model, a study was performed using data of four existing fishing vessels. Two smaller vessels operate in the Adriatic and two larger in the Ionian Sea. The models developed from the experimental basis and model developed from the systematic seakeeping calculations produce comparable predictions.
